The WARN Act — your notification rights

The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ification (WARN) Act requires employers with 100+ employees to provide 60 calendar days advance notice of mass layoffs (50+ employees at a single site) or plant closings. Key points:

Severance — what you're entitled to vs what you can negotiate

The US has no federal law requiring severance pay. Severance is determined by your employment contract, company policy, or negotiation at termination. However:

Unemployment Insurance (UI) — apply immediately

If you were laid off (not fired for cause), you are generally eligible for unemployment insurance through your state's workforce agency. Key points:

Explaining a layoff in US interviews

"The company went through a significant RIF in Q1 2026 that eliminated my entire division as part of a restructuring. It was a business decision — not performance related. I received strong references from my manager and director, and I've stayed in touch with the team. Since then, I've been [consulting / taking courses / building / networking] and I'm now focused on finding the right next opportunity where I can contribute to [connect to target role]."
